INDIANAPOLIS —The historic Indianapolis Propylaeum, 1410 N. Delaware St. #2, is home to many beautiful sites, one being the old carriage house, formally the original Children’s Museum. This enchanting structure will be where the Autism Society of Indiana hosts their “Afternoon Tea for Autism” event June 15th from 1 p.m. – 4 p.m. Tickets are $18 per person with $6 from each going to benefit ASI. All of the proceeds stay in Indiana to help families affected by autism. Ticket sale ends June 12th.
Included in the afternoon is a selection from three different teas, three sandwiches, two scones, and eight desserts. Tea will be served from genuine antique sets and guests can enjoy exploring the beautiful carriage house, request tours of the Propylaeum, and walk the grounds.
